Rakiyah Jackson, a former Garfield High School star now playing for the Western Washington Vikings, will compete in the NCAA Division II Basketball Tournament.

The Vikings secured the No. 2 seed and are set to play the No. 7 seed Point Loma Sea Lions in their opening matchup.

The game is scheduled for Friday, March 13, at 2:30 p.m. at Nicholson Arena.
